Head of Tenancy and Neighbourhood Services

First Choice Homes Oldham - oldham, north west england

Apply Now

Job Description

Head of Tenancy and Neighbourhood ServicesLocation: Hybrid – Office and Home BasedSalary: Circa £70,000 per AnnumContract Type: Permanent, Full-TimeShape Thriving Communities – Lead Meaningful ChangeAre you a strategic and people-focused housing leader passionate about creating better neighbourhoods? Do you thrive in a collaborative environment where you can drive innovation, performance, and social impact?At FCHO, we're on a mission to build thriving communities where people feel safe, connected, and supported. As Head of Tenancy and Neighbourhood Services, you’ll play a pivotal role in turning that mission into reality.The vacancyReporting to the Director of Customer Services, you’ll lead four critical services: Neighbourhoods, Lettings, and ASB. Your leadership will ensure our services not only meet but exceed regulatory standards, deliver exceptional customer satisfaction, and create real impact in our communities.You’ll develop and implement neighbourhood action plans and innovative interventions using a systems thinking approach – all while ensuring compliance with regulatory frameworks like the Regulator of Social Housing’s Consumer Standards and Tenant Satisfaction Measures (TSMs).So what will you be doing?In this role your responsibilities will be:Lead and inspire multidisciplinary teamsDrive continuous service improvement through data, insight, and customer feedbackDevelop policies, systems, and KPIs to strengthen delivery and accountabilityBuild strong partnerships with statutory and voluntary agenciesEnsure legal, regulatory, and safeguarding compliance across your service areasPlay a key role in shaping FCHO’s “Thriving Communities” agendaWho are we looking for?Essential Requirements:Has a full UK driving licenceHas substantial experience managing multi-disciplinary housing teams (Neighbourhoods, Lettings, ASB, etc.)Holds a CIH Level 5 Diploma (or equivalent/willingness to complete), with in-depth knowledge of relevant housing legislationHas strong strategic and analytical skills and is able to turn insight into actionHas excellent people and performance management expertiseHas a track record of creating and delivering customer-centric servicesHas vast experience of budget management and policy developmentIs committed to equality, diversity, and creating safe, inclusive communitiesWhat's in it for you?When you become a part of the FCHO team, you receive a range of fantastic benefits, including:A 37-hour working week with hybrid working optionsHoliday entitlement is 30 days plus one shut down day and eight bank holidays.Defined contribution pension scheme with an employer contribution of up to 10%.
